A Woman Called Sage DiAnn Mills Paperback, 320 pp., $12.99 Zondervan (April 1, 2010)
In A Woman Called Sage, a high-energy historical romance novel set in the late 1800s by award-winning author DiAnn Mills, Sage Morrow has lost everything she loved. Now, she is a Colorado bounty hunter determined to track down and bring killers to justice… and it’s personal. But when the tables are turned, will Sage become the one who is hunted?

Breach of Trust
DiAnn Mills
Paperback, 350 pp., $12.99
Tyndale House Publishers (March 1, 2009)
Paige Rogers survived every CIA operative’s worst nightmare: a covert mission gone terribly wrong, and a betrayal by the one man she thought she could trust. Forced to disappear to protect the lives of her loved ones, Paige has spent the last several years building a quiet life as a small-town librarian. But the day a stranger comes to town and starts asking questions, Paige knows her careful existence has been shattered. He is coming after her again. And this time, he intends to silence her for good.
When the Nile Runs Red DiAnn Mills Paperback, 336 pp., $12.99 Moody Publishers (September 1, 2007)
Paul Farid was once a member of the Sudanese royal family; now he’s a Christian who puts his life on the line to aid those he once persecuted. His wife, Larson, is a doctor committed to giving her life for peace. Colonel Ben Alier has fought for twenty-one years against the government’s mandates to control the oil, religion, slavery, and politics of Sudan. He neither trusts nor rests any hope in the newly formed government. Their worlds collide, and as the tensions escalate, so does the physical danger.
